“My husband and I recently spent four nights at the St Paul Hotel while attending the Minnesota Yacht Club music festival. The location was the initial draw as it was walking distance to the venue. We travel quite a bit and have stayed in many nice hotels and we both agreed that this was one of our favorites! The building itself is beautiful and our room was immaculate. Some of the best room service and house keeping we’ve experienced. The St Paul Grill is the onsite restaurant and the food and service was superb! A bit pricey but well worth it. There is also a lobby bar which has coffee and pastries in the mornings or you can have breakfast at the Drake which was also amazing. It’s rare that we leave a place with no complaints but it happened during this stay! Book a stay at the St Paul. You will not be disappointed!”

“I stayed here one night for a concert at the palace theater on a Saturday night. My friend and I walked to the palace and back and felt safe.
Look up on the hotels website where they recommend to park. If you're prepared, it's easy enough.
Interesting history to the hotel gave some charm to staying here vs any other cookie cutter hotel. Rooms were clean and the free breakfast was delicious. The food and drinks at the hotel bar/restaurant was delicious but a little pricey. We were prepared for that being in the city though. I'll definitely stay here again if I'm ever needing to be in the area.”
